Maintenance Requests
Renter Answers
It is a good idea for renters to submit all requests for repairs in writing to their property manager. Although verbal requests are acceptable, putting them in writing will minimize misunderstandings that cause delays to the repairs. Keep a copy of your written request in case a dispute arises.
Once notified of the request for repairs, the property manager should promptly inform the renter of the date and time the repairs will be made and provide the name of the person or company that will do the work. Unless it is an emergency, the property manager should provide a written notice to enter the residence at least 24 hours in advance and perform the work during regular business hours.
